Bas-Rhin. Eternal Pollutants: Systematic Analyses of Drinking Water Abstractions in 2026

Summary by dna.fr
While the new standards for drinking water contamination at the PFAS will come into effect in January, the Alsace and Moselle Water and Sanitation Union (SDEA) is preparing a systematic analysis of its catchments to confirm the absence of pollution to eternal pollutants.
